Aircraft B738 is registered in with tail number G-JZBL. It is operated by and its age is 7 years (built in 2018). The aircraft weight is 41413 kg and it has 2 engines Jet with power of 121,4 kN kN each. The length of the plane is 39.5 m. The height of the plane is 12.57 m. The wing span is 34.32 m.
